  • Objectives This study was implemented to investigate the distribution of Sasang constitution and prescription of the patients with coldness in hands and feet.Methods Sixteen patients with coldness were analyzed in terms of age, Sasang constitution, season and prescriptions.Results The distribution of Sasang constitution of the patients with coldness in hands and feet was like Taeeumin 50%, Soeumin 43.8% and Soyangin 6.2%. And the date of consultation of the patients is different seasonally, 50% of the patients visited in winter, 18.8% in spring and fall respectively and 6.3% in summer. The frequency by age group is different was like 31.3% of the patients visited in 20s, 18.8% in 10s, 30s and 50s, 12.5% in 40s. In terms of Exterior and Interior diseases, Soyanging and Soeumin patients were categorized in Interior diseases while Taeeumin patients were categorized in Exterior disease.Conclusions Patients with coldness in hands and feet were mostly classified into Taeeumin and Soeumin and the prevalence of its symptom was high in their 20s. Patients were willing to visit clinics in winter. The Exterior/Interior diseases and mild/severe diseases were different according to Sasang constitution.

  • The aim of this study was to evaluate autophagy-enhancing and neuroprotective effects of Wonji-Gobon mixture (WGM), a traditional Chinese prescription medication, in Parkinson's disease (PD) mouse models. Our investigation found that WGM increased the expression of both Beclin1 and LC3b-II proteins as measured with western blot in the BV2 cell line; both proteins play a role in autophagy. WGM also increased the autophagy expression as measured by fluorescence-activated cell-sorting analysis in the BV2 cell line. In 1-methyl-4-phenyl-1,2,3,6-tetrahydropyridine-induced PD models, WGM significantly increased the amount of dopamine in a striatum-substantia nigra suspension, produced notable results in the forced swim test, and increased serotonin as measured by high-performance liquid chromatography analysis; these results are indicative of neuroprotective effects. In summary, our findings indicate that WGM treatment has neuroprotective effects that are partially mediated by autophagy enhancement.

  • Objectives: The present study reports a case of chronic anemia patient who was significantly improved after taking Nokyongdaebo-tang (NYDBT) Methods: A 48-year-old male patient diagnosed with iron deficiency anemia (IDA) visited the Daejeon Korean medicine Hospital of Daejeon University on June 2018. The patient was treated with Korean medicine for 23 months including acupuncture, herbal medicine and Sasang constitutional medicine prescription. Improvement of anemia was assessed by changes of Hemoglobin value. Laboratory analysis was used to evaluate the safety of treatment. Results: Chronic anemia has significantly improved since taking NYDBT on 9 days (2019.12.09-2019.12.17). The Hb value has been maintained in the normal range since it first entered the normal range on January 18, 2020. The patient had become transfusion-free and this condition persisted for 6 months after stopping the transfusion. Conclusion: This case demonstrates the therapeutic potential of Sasang constitutional medicine for chronic anemia as a personalized medicine.

  • Objectives The object of this study was to observe the effects of Hyeongbangjihwhang-tang (HB; Soyangin prescription) on the 5/6 NTX induced CRF rats. Methods Each of Hyeongbangjihwhang-tang aqueous extracts 200mg/kg were orally administered once a day for 35 days from 4 weeks after 5/6 NTX surgery. Four groups, each of 8 rats per group were used in this study, were sham group, CRF group, ${\alpha}$-Tocoperol group and HB group. Changes on the left remnant kidney weights, serum BUN, creatinine levels, caspase-3, PARP immunoreactivities were observed to nephroprotective effects, and relative immunomodulatory effects were monitored based on the changes of lymphatic organ weights and splenic cytokine contents. In addition, the changes on the kidney MDA, GSH contents and SOD, CAT activities were also calculated for antioxidant effects, and the effects on the CRF related cachexia were demonstrated based on the changes of body and epididymal fat pad weights, serum TG, TC, LDL and HDL levels. Results and Conclusions 1) HB was significantly decreased the left remnant kidney weights, serum BUN, creatinine levels and caspase-3, PARP immunoreactivities. 2) HB was significantly increased lymphatic organ weights and splenic cytokine contents. 3) HB was significantly increased body and epididymal fat pad weights, and was significantly decreased serum TG, TC, LDL and HDL levels. 4) HB was significantly decreased MDA contents, and was significantly increased GSH contents and SOD, CAT activities. The results obtained in this study suggest that HB significantly retarded immunosuppressions and cachexia related to the 5/6 NTX induced CRF through modulations of oxidative defense systems. Especially HB showed the highest favorable effects more than those of ${\alpha}$-tocoperol.

  • 1. Purpose : The correct constitutional diagnosis and the accurate prescription are very important in clinical application of Sasang Constitutional Medicine. Lee Je-ma emphasized that symptom is the best clue to diagnose constitution in "DongYi Suse Bowon". After research the characteristics of each constitution's symptoms and the backgrounds of constitutional prescriptions, this paper is to know the correct clinical application of Sasang Constitutional Medicine. 2. Method : Through the clinical applications of "DongYi Soose Bowon" and "Dongyi Sasang Sinpeun", the characteristics of constitutional symptoms and the application of prescription were researched 3. Results & Conclusions 1) The symptoms of Sasang Constitutional Medicine were came from the Hyung-Sang Medicine(形象醫學) which were important to mind-body equally and from the summarizing spirit of four Qi such as Warm-Hot-Cool-Cold(溫熱凉寒) 2) The symptoms of Soeumin and Soyangin are the Cold-Hot symptoms of ingestive food(水穀) and the treatment of symptoms is to control the ascent-descent of up and down. The symptoms of Taeumin and Taeyangin are the Warm-Cool symptoms of Qi-Yack(氣液) and the treatment of symptom is to control the unfasten-fasten of interior and exterior. 3) The symptoms of Taeyangin are 'Weak Lower part and Firm Upper part symptom'(下虛上實病證) and 'Blood and Yack Exhasted Symptom'(血液俱耗病證), the symptoms of Soeumin are 'Fall Down Symptom'(下陷病證) and Stomach Cold Symptom(胃寒病證), the symptoms of taeumin is 'Dryness Fever Symptom'(燥熱病證) and 'Interior Fever Symptom'(燥熱病證), the symptoms of Soyangin is 'Fire Fever Symptom'(火熱病證) and 'Interior Fever Symptom'(燥熱病證). 4) The characteristics of sasang constitutional symptoms are the exterior-interior symptoms classified with nature-emotion and cool-hot, the inclusive control of exterior-interior symptoms with healthy energy, and the classification of ingestive food symptoms and Qi-Yack symptoms. 5) The characteristics to treat symptoms are the classification of seriousness and obedience, the use herbs according to each constitutions, and inclusive symptoms control.
